An evaluation of erosion risks and design of erosion control measures in selected cadastral area
Janota, Petr ; Janků, Jaroslava (advisor) ; Karel, Karel (referee)
Erosion is exogenous geomorphological process that affects the formation of the Earth's surface since the formation of the Earth's solid crust. This activity, which under natural conditions proceeded slowly, in terms of human generations imperceptibly, in intensively used landscape dramatically accelerated and brought a number of adverse consequences. The aim of this study has been to assess and evaluate erosion risks in selected cadastral area and in the event of an over limit erosion hazard to suggest appropriate erosion control measures to eliminate the increased erosion. The 77 erosion of closed units were examined by a computer program Atlas DMT erosion module, which uses digital terrain model together with data from databases or BPEJ or LPIS. The 14 of them have diagnosed overlimit value wash away the soil. As a basic erosion control measures the change of applied classic crop rotation to crop rotations using soil conservation technologies was considered. After adjusting cropping practices that positively impact factor of the protective effects of vegetation, it was found by erosion Atlas module, six parcels of land with over limited value of soil washes. These lands have suggested the use of technical erosion control measures, for example furrows, grassing thalwegs etc.. On the parcels, where, due to their size, shape or morphology technical measures proved inadequate or ineffective it has been proposed permanent grassing. In the proposals erosion control measures it is necessary to combine the maximum efficiency of measures with condition of ease and minimal restriction of land users. When their making is to be assumed towards the user, because it depends on him only whether the proposed organizational and agronomic measures will be implemented or not. The fundamental problem with these measures is that their implementation is not backed by legislation. I assume that the more acceptable, less restrictive and inexpensive measures will be proposed, the more likely it will be implemented. One of the reasons why even the simple erosion control measures are put into practice slowly and with difficulty is the fact that in the Czech Republic the most of the agricultural land is managed by entities that are not its owners. This fact significantly contributes to the fact that land is viewed merely as a means of production, which must to bring maximum profit only. To improve this situation may also contribute to the establishment and consistent control of the GAEC standards.

Surface runoff generation and its erosion processes
Kalibová, Jana ; Kovář, Pavel (advisor) ; Štibinger, Jakub (referee)
Research of model simulations of hydrological data for water resources studies and field and laboratory experiments testing the effectiveness of erosion control geotextiles using rainfall simulators is summarized in this dissertation. The results of the research have been used to suggest a water regime optimisation in the catchment of a former mining pit Medard-Libík. Although agricultural and forestry reclamation measures have been applied, rill erosion still appears on some slopes within the catchment. The soil loss and sediment transport result in the deterioration of the crop yield, cause damage on the road and drainage systems and also influence the quality of water in the lake arising by flooding the former mining pit. The first part of the dissertation provides a review on surface runoff and its erosion processes. Next, bio-technical erosion control measures on slopes are summarised. The third part of the dissertation is devoted to a simulation of surface runoff on a model slope in the Medard Catchment. The main aim was to test whether the KINFIL model is suitable for the simulation of the effectiveness of erosion control geotextiles and suggest an appropriate erosion control measures for the eroded slopes in the Medard Catchment. The KINFIL model seems to be a useful tool to quantify the effectiveness of individual erosion control products and measures in order to find the most convenient option. The simulations carried out in the dissertation corresponded to the results of field and laboratory experiments testing the impact of geotextiles on surface runoff and soil erosion published earlier. A well-balanced rainfall-runoff regime in the Medard Catchment would increase the stability of the landscape, reduce the cost of restoration of the damage caused by erosion to road and drainage systems and improve the water quality by elimination of the sediment transport. The results of this dissertation may be offered to the public administration or private stakeholders to control erosion within the reclamation of areas affected by mining activities.

Utilization of biological and chemical amelioration treatments for restoration of anthropogenic degraded locality near Boleboř village in Ore Mts.
Kouba, Martin ; Podrázský, Vilém (advisor)
This dissertation contains evaluation of the growth dynamics and nutritional status of tree species plantations after application of biological and chemical amelioration treatments, impact of trees on quality of soil and on the accumulation of surface humus. There were evaluated: Norway spruce (Picea abies L.), Blue spruce (Picea pungens Engelm.), Birch (Betula spp.), European larch (Larix decidua Mill.), Gray alder (Alnus incana Moench.), Lodgepole pine (Pinus contorta Dougl.), Eastern White pine (Pinus strobus L.) and Rowan (Sorbus aucuparia L.). On 4 research plots in Boleboř (Ore Mts.) was measured height, thickness of root collar, breast-height diameter. Were taken samples of soil, weed and assimilation apparatus. There was determined yellowing, browsing, plants mortality and calculated amount of accumulated surface humus. Application of fertilizer Silvamix Forte on spreading windrows reduced mortality and increased increment for the first 3 years, the effect is evident even after 10 years. It was not confirmed the attractiveness of plants for wildlife after Silvamix Forte application. Silvamix Mg fertilizer application had minimal effect on the growth dynamics and nutrient contents in needles. Positively impacted soil characteristics, increased the value of the cation exchange capacity, decrease in hydrolytic acidity, increase the saturation of sorption bases, decrease of aluminium ions Al3+ and decrease of Fe2O3. On fertilized plots increased content of available nitrogen, phosphorus, calcium and magnesium, increase of the total supply of nitrogen, calcium and magnesium. The rapid increase in the content of Ca and Mg is related to the liming in 2002. Fertilizer application significantly supported the development of ground-weed on plots of Colorado blue spruce mixed with birch, while in pure stands of Colorado blue spruce led to a reduction in aboveground biomass. For the Colorado blue spruce mixed with birch plot compared with only Colorado blue spruce plot were documented favourable soil properties, increased supply of total nitrogen, phosphorus and potassium. Rowan tree on an intact soil surface exhibits the lowest reaction pH as humus and in the mineral, high hydrolytic acidity, extremely sorption unsaturated soil state, high content of ion Al3+ and low content of available calcium, although was applied liming. Technical and biological reclamation (Boleboř III.) has a long-term positive effect on the average height and breast-height diameter of Colorado blue spruce and white pine. The growth dynamics of European larch and Lodgepole pine were affect only at the beginning. Meliorated stand of Gray Alder has very good growth dynamics, comparable with Larch and Lodgepole pine. The big problem is the game impact, especially in Lodgepole pine, which led to the destruction of all individuals. Colorado Blue spruce in terms of biological reclamation is totally inappropriate. This Spruce has reduced resistance to abiotic factors, which often suffer uprooting and breakage. During the 21 years the Clorado Blue spruce mixed with birch accumulated of 66,09 t.ha-1 humus matter with better properties also in the deeper horizon. Colorado Blue spruce accumulated 54,11 t.ha-1 of humus matter. Rowan tree accumulated on the intact soil largest amount of humus matter (194,98 t.ha-1), however acidifies the deeper horizons. The stand of Norway Spruce occurred during the reporting period a decrease of 47% to 107,03 t.ha-1. The decline may be associated with more open stand and due to air liming.
